Understanding Pay Stub and Its Importance

Before diving into how a pay stub generator works, it’s important to understand what a pay stub is and why it’s crucial for both employees and employers. A pay stub is a document that breaks down the details of an employee’s earnings, deductions, and reimbursements. It’s usually provided along with the employee’s paycheck to give a clear breakdown of how their earnings are calculated.

Typically, a pay stub will include:

  • Gross earnings (the total amount before deductions)

  • Deductions (taxes, insurance premiums, retirement contributions, etc.)

  • Net pay (the amount the employee actually takes home)

  • Reimbursements for business-related expenses, such as travel costs

For employees, a pay stub serves as a detailed record of their earnings, helping them understand how their pay was calculated. For employers, providing accurate and timely pay stubs is essential for compliance with labor laws and for maintaining transparency in the workplace.

How Travel Expense Reimbursements Fit into Pay Stubs

Many businesses require employees to travel for work, whether it’s for meetings, conferences, or sales calls. As a result, employers often reimburse employees for the costs incurred during business trips, such as airfare, hotel accommodations, meals, and transportation.

These reimbursements are typically separate from the employee’s regular wages but need to be documented clearly in the pay stub for transparency and record-keeping purposes. Without proper documentation, employees may have difficulty verifying their expenses, and businesses could face challenges when preparing tax reports or audits.

Here are some common travel expenses that might be reimbursed:

  • Airfare or train tickets

  • Hotel accommodations

  • Meals and incidental expenses

  • Taxi or rental car fees

  • Mileage for personal vehicle use

By including these reimbursements on the paycheck stub, businesses ensure that employees are accurately compensated for their work-related travel expenses. Best Practices for Managing Travel Expense Reimbursements

If your business involves frequent employee travel, it’s essential to have a system in place for managing travel expense reimbursements. Here are some best practices to consider:

  1. Set Clear Reimbursement Policies
    Establish clear policies regarding what qualifies as a reimbursable travel expense and set limits on amounts where necessary. For example, you may specify a maximum amount for meals or require that receipts be provided for all expenses.

  2. Keep Detailed Records
    Maintaining accurate records of all travel expenses is vital for both reimbursement purposes and tax compliance. Encourage employees to submit receipts promptly and track their expenses using expense reporting software or apps.
